Cracks or damage already present in concrete play a significant role in the cost of concrete repair. There is no doubt that more extensive repairs require more time and effort, resulting in a higher cost.
Concrete cracks are the most common form of damage, which can be caused by a variety of factors, including extreme weather conditions or excessive weight. In any case, Cloud Concrete can provide an accurate estimate for repair before any work begins, regardless of the cause of the damage.
Costs are also heavily influenced by the size of the damaged area. The cost of repairing a small crack in your driveway will be much lower than repairing a large section that has sunk or been lifted.

The third cost factor is the type of work that needs to be done. There are some types of concrete repair that require more effort, time, and materials than others.
In order to lift concrete back into place, mudjacking involves injecting a special mud-like substance beneath the concrete. It is possible for slabs to be lifted due to poor soil conditions or erosion.
The cost of mudjacking is generally lower than other types of concrete repair, but it's still important to consider the type of work needed.

Concrete that has lifted or sunken is often caused by issues with soil. A concrete repair job is often estimated based on soil conditions.
Over time, the concrete is more likely to settle or sink if the soil beneath it is particularly soft or loose. The overall cost of concrete leveling can be affected by the soil's condition, which can usually be remedied with mudjacking.

Access to the property can also affect the cost of concrete repair. Our team may need to use specialized equipment in some cases to reach the area that needs to be repaired.
Consider the cost of this equipment rental when considering your concrete repair budget if this is the case.
Concrete repair jobs are not all the same. In order to complete some tasks efficiently and on time, it may be necessary to assemble a larger team.
When considering your budget, it's important to factor in the cost of additional manpower if your repair job is particularly large or complex.
The cost of concrete repair may be covered by your insurance policy in some cases. Often, this is the case when your property has been damaged by something like a tree falling.
In order to determine whether concrete repair is covered by your insurance policy, contact your provider in advance. Although they may not cover the entire expense, they may offer some coverage that can help offset the cost.

Last but not least, when considering your budget, you should consider the cost of immediate concrete repairs if they are an emergency. Many concrete lifting companies have busy schedules, so they will charge a bit more for repairs that need to be completed quickly.
